Create CVA Supply Chain Manager resume is evaluated as a cost-efficiency and risk-control document. It is not screened like a general operations resume, and it is not judged solely on logistics coordination. Recruiters and ATS systems assess whether the candidate can optimize procurement strategy, reduce total landed cost, stabilize supplier networks, and protect margin through forecasting and inventory governance.
Modern supply chain hiring prioritizes resilience, global sourcing strategy, inventory turnover performance, and cross-border risk mitigation. This page explains how Supply Chain Manager resumes are evaluated, where they fail, and how high-performing leaders position measurable impact.
Applicant tracking systems evaluate resumes using semantic clusters tied to:
•Inventory turnover metrics
• Demand forecasting models
• Supplier performance management
• Procurement cost reduction
• ERP system integration
• Global logistics coordination
• Lead time optimization
A resume stating “managed supply chain operations” provides minimal ranking value.
Low-impact statement: “Handled procurement and logistics.”
High-impact statement: “Led end-to-end supply chain operations across $220M annual spend portfolio, reducing total landed cost by 14% and improving inventory turnover from 5.2 to 8.1 within two fiscal years.”
The second statement improves ATS performance because it includes:
•Spend magnitude
• Quantifiable cost reduction
• Inventory performance metrics
• Time-bound improvement
Supply chain resumes are ranked based on measurable efficiency and financial impact.
Strong resumes specify:
•Annual procurement spend
• SKU volume managed
• Distribution footprint
• Vendor portfolio size
Without financial or operational scale, seniority cannot be validated.
Recruiters look for:
•Total landed cost reduction
• Vendor renegotiation outcomes
• Freight optimization savings
• Inventory carrying cost reduction
Supply chain leadership is directly tied to margin performance.
Modern supply chain roles require:
•Dual-sourcing strategies
• Supplier risk assessment
• Geopolitical risk mitigation
• Contingency inventory planning
Absence of resilience planning signals outdated supply chain positioning.
High-performing resumes include references to:
•ERP implementation
• Demand planning software
• Forecast accuracy improvement
• Inventory optimization algorithms
Technology integration signals strategic modernization.

Generic statements like:
•Improved supply chain efficiency
• Managed suppliers
Do not demonstrate financial leverage.
Inventory turnover, stockout reduction, and carrying cost improvements are essential. Without them, resumes lack operational depth.
Modern supply chain hiring expects:
•SAP
• Oracle
• NetSuite
• Demand planning platforms
Omitting systems experience weakens positioning.
High-performing resumes include:
•Reduced total landed cost by 18%
• Improved forecast accuracy from 72% to 91%
• Decreased inventory carrying cost by $4.8M annually
• Increased inventory turnover from 4.9 to 7.6
• Reduced lead times by 35%
• Negotiated $12M in supplier savings
Metrics signal margin protection and operational control.
